Abstract
An automatic radioisotope filling apparatus which includes a radioisotope vial containing a radioisotope solution, a saline vial containing a physiological saline solution and a plurality of label vials containing a drug into which a predetermined amount of the radioisotope solution or the physiological saline solution is to be filled automatically. A required amount of the radioisotope solution or the physiological saline solution is automatically metered and automatically filled into each label vial and consequently the radiation exposure of the operator of the apparatus is minimized.
